The Corvane schema registry began failing signature checks on all schema uploads after Tuesday's cert rotation. Producers can't register new event versions; consumers fall back to cached schemas. Verified the payloads are intact — digests match. Root cause appears to be the registry pinning the retired verification key rather than pulling from the trust bundle. Requesting security review before we re-pin, since this bypasses normal rotation. The registry should be pinned to the key below.

rollout seal: bky3_Zik

TURN-208: Gatevale turnstile counters at the Merrow Field pilot double-count when a rotation reverses mid-cycle. Attendance totals drift roughly 2% high per event. The debounce window fix is implemented, reviewed by Ilsa, and soak-tested across two simulated match days without drift. Ready for your cut; the candidate build is identified below.

trace token, tagag-tafog: htk6_5ed18c

This release reworks the Levenshtein-distance matcher to weight keyboard-adjacency substitutions more heavily, reducing false negatives on single-character swaps. We also added registry snapshot caching (24-hour TTL) so repeated scans of the Pellbrook mirror no longer hammer the index. Future maintainers should note that the allowlist format changed from flat text to structured TOML; a migration script is included under tools/. Any questions about the matcher internals or the cache invalidation logic should go to the owner identified below.

approver of bagug-bagag = Holael Pramir